Key takeaways for renters

  • The bottom line

    Melbourne, FL rent slipped 10.1% year over year, with a current median of $1,750/month. Renters today are paying $230 less per month than last year, while month-to-month rent is essentially flat.

  • Melbourne is 7.9% more affordable than the $1,900/month national median, with 185 total rentals offering a smaller but accessible market for renters.

  • Price ranges

    Studios in Melbourne rent for $1,204/month, 1-bedrooms for $1,295/month, 2-bedrooms for $1,600/month, 3-bedrooms for $1,995/month, and 4+ bedrooms for $2,800/month. Houses rent for $2,160/month while apartments sit at $1,495/month, reflecting the inventory split with houses making up 65.1% of rentals.

  • Neighborhood spotlight

    Golf Club Estates rents fell 54.4% year over year to $1,595/month, Weston Park dropped 51.5% to $1,600/month, and Eagle Harbor declined 50.8% to $1,610/month. These local declines contrast with the citywide 10.1% drop and show concentrated cooldowns in these neighborhoods.

Frequently asked questions for Melbourne, FL

Quick answers to common questions about the Melbourne rental market.

How much is rent in Melbourne?

The average rent in Melbourne is $1,750 per month as of September 12, 2026.

Is rent up or down in Melbourne?

Average rent prices in Melbourne have remained the same over the last month and have decreased by 10% since last year.

How does Melbourne rent compare to the national average?

Rent in Melbourne is 8% below the national average, which means renters are paying approximately $150 less per month.

Which neighborhoods are most affordable in Melbourne?

The most affordable neighborhoods in Melbourne are Bowe Gardens ($1,400/mo), Sunwood Park ($1,450/mo), and Sherwood Park ($1,650/mo).

What salary do I need to afford rent in Melbourne?

To comfortably afford rent in Melbourne, you'd need to earn approximately $70,000/year, based on spending no more than 30% of your income on rent.

When is the best time of year to rent in Melbourne?

December offers the lowest rents in Melbourne, with prices running about 3.7% below the February peak season. September and October also see less competitive conditions with reduced demand.

Methodology

Rent prices are based on Zumper's rental listings from the past 30 days. Median rent is calculated across all available listings and property types on the platform. If you filter the page by bedroom count or property type, the pricing throughout the page will update automatically to reflect that segment of the rental market.

Household and population data come from the U.S. Census Bureau. Cost-of-living data is sourced from the Council for Community and Economic Research's Cost of Living Index (COLI).
